# 🔒 Security Audit Workflow
## Dependency Vulnerability Scan
```bash
# Run npm security audit
npm audit --json > audit-report.json
# Check critical and high vulnerabilities
CRITICAL=$(cat audit-report.json | jq '.metadata.vulnerabilities.critical // 0')
HIGH=$(cat audit-report.json | jq '.metadata.vulnerabilities.high // 0')
echo "Critical vulnerabilities: $CRITICAL"
echo "High vulnerabilities: $HIGH"
# Auto-fix if possible
npm audit fix
```
## Code Security Pattern Analysis
```bash
# Scan for hardcoded secrets
grep -r "password\|secret\|key\|token" --include="*.js" --include="*.ts" src/
# Check for SQL injection patterns
grep -r "SELECT.*+\|INSERT.*+" --include="*.js" --include="*.ts" src/
# Detect XSS vulnerabilities
grep -r "innerHTML\|document.write\|eval" --include="*.js" --include="*.ts" src/
# Find insecure HTTP usage
grep -r "http://" --exclude-dir=node_modules .
```
## Configuration Security Review
```bash
# Check environment file protection
if [ -f ".env" ]; then
grep -q "\.env" .gitignore || echo "WARNING: .env not in .gitignore"
fi
# Validate package.json security
grep -q "sudo\|postinstall" package.json && echo "WARNING: Potentially unsafe scripts"
# Docker security check
if [ -f "Dockerfile" ]; then
grep -q "USER" Dockerfile || echo "WARNING: Running as root user"
fi
```
## Security Middleware Validation
```bash
# Check for security packages
grep -q "helmet" package.json && echo "✅ Security headers configured"
grep -q "cors" package.json && echo "✅ CORS configured"
grep -q "rate-limit" package.json && echo "✅ Rate limiting configured"
```
**🎯 Result:** Comprehensive security assessment with prioritized remediation recommendations
